Today in History
- Napoléon Bonaparte crowns himself Emperor of the French (1804)
 - US President James Monroe proclaims the “Monroe Doctrine” in his State of the Union message (1823)
 - Abolitionist leader John Brown is hanged (1859)
 - A team led by Enrico Fermi initiates the first self-sustaining nuclear chain reaction (1942)
 - A Luftwaffe raid on Bari, Italy, results in a release of World War I-era mustard gas on board the SS John Harvey; among its side effects is the development of an early form of chemotherapy (1943)
 - The US Senate votes to censure Joseph McCarthy (1954)
 - Fidel Castro formally declares that he is a Marxist-Leninist and that Cuba will adopt communism (1961)
 - The EPA begins operations (1970)
 - Barney Clark becomes the first person to receive a permanent artificial heart (1982)
 - Benazir Bhutto becomes the first woman to head the government of an Islam-majority state (1988)
 - Enron files for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ection (2001)
